WebMar 2, 2024 · Clicking is often commonly referred to as bruxing and it is a sound that hamsters make when they rub their teeth together to make a clicking sound. This sound can be compared to a cat’s purr and is pretty much always a sign that your hamster is happy and content with whatever is happening. 10. Chirping. WebApr 29, 2015 · The following is a list of behaviors and what they mean. Burrowing in bedding: This means a hamster is happy and just digging around playing or searching for a possible snack it may have buried earlier. Watching you with its ears erect: A hamster behavior like this means it is just a bit curious about what is going on and in a calm way.
